    Hi have a video file that need to put in narration in wav format, however after incorporate both narration sound and video and render them. The wav sound at 0db volume is too soft. But when i increasing the volume…i can hear loud noise at the background..how do i increase the wav volume but without an noise background. BTW.. i render the video in MOV and compression by photo JPEG.

    I’d go with the Bass & Treble effect, High-Low Pass effect or the Parametric EQ effect.
    All found in Effects > Audio Effects.

    If it were me, I’d take the wav file into Audition (or a similar audio editor), and use the noise reduction filter, to reduce the background noise. Then increase the amplitude and save.

    With any sound program you should check the Reduce Noise filter and the Normalize filter.

    Also the Amplify can help you with the volume, but it can clip it, so be careful.

    This is what I always do:

    -Open the file and apply Normalize.

    -Then, apply the Noise Reduction filter (usually getting a noise sample first, and then applying the filter).

    -And finally, if needed, a Limiter.
